【如何使用云手机远程真机调试BUG】在移动应用开发过程中,测试和调试是不可或缺的环节。随着技术的发展,越来越多开发者开始借助“云手机”进行远程真机调试,以提高效率、节省成本。本文将总结如何使用云手机进行远程真机调试,并提供实用信息供参考。
一、云手机远程真机调试的核心流程
步骤 | 操作内容 | 说明 |
1 | 注册并选择云手机服务 | 如阿里云、腾讯云、华为云等平台均提供云手机服务,可根据需求选择合适的平台。 |
2 | 创建或选择一台云手机实例 | 根据设备型号、系统版本、网络环境等配置云手机实例。 |
3 | 安装被测应用 | 通过云端上传APK文件或直接从应用商店安装目标应用。 |
4 | 连接本地开发环境 | 使用ADB(Android Debug Bridge)工具连接云手机,实现远程调试。 |
5 | 执行调试操作 | 在本地IDE中运行调试命令,观察日志、执行断点、查看UI界面等。 |
6 | 记录与分析问题 | 通过日志输出、截图、视频录制等方式记录BUG表现,便于后续修复。 |
二、常见云手机平台对比
平台名称 | 是否支持真机模拟 | 系统版本选择 | 网络稳定性 | 费用模式 | 适用场景 |
阿里云云手机 | 支持 | 多种机型 | 高 | 按时计费 | 大型项目、多设备测试 |
腾讯云云手机 | 支持 | 基础机型 | 中 | 按量/包月 | 中小型团队 |
华为云云手机 | 支持 | 基础机型 | 高 | 按时计费 | 国内用户、稳定需求 |
七陌云手机 | 支持 | 多种系统 | 中 | 按次计费 | 快速测试、临时任务 |
三、注意事项
- 网络环境:确保本地电脑与云手机之间网络稳定,避免因延迟影响调试体验。
- 权限设置:在云手机上开启“USB调试”模式,并允许未知来源应用安装。
- 日志记录:建议在调试过程中开启详细的日志输出,便于快速定位问题。
- 版本兼容性:选择与实际用户设备匹配的系统版本,提升测试准确性。
四、总结
使用云手机进行远程真机调试,不仅能够突破物理设备限制,还能显著提升开发效率。通过合理选择云平台、配置合适的设备,并结合ADB等工具,开发者可以高效地完成应用测试与BUG修复工作。对于中小型团队或个人开发者来说,这种方式尤其具有性价比优势。
如需进一步优化调试流程,可结合自动化测试框架,实现更高效的持续集成与交付。